Franchise leads Jennifer Lawrence and Josh Hutcherson will appear in the upcoming Hunger Games film, Sunrise on the Reaping.
News has broken that fan-favorite stars Jennifer Lawrence and Josh Hutcherson are set to appear once again in the latest chapter of the Hunger Games film series, titled The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ping. The project is now in the works.
A Significant Reunion for Fans
The actors are slated to play Katniss Everdeen and Peeta Mellark, respectively. It is believed their appearance will likely occur in a future-set scene, considering the main film series concluded with their characters married and with children.
This marks the sixth installment in the global Hunger Games franchise.
Exploring the New Story
Sunrise on the Reaping draws its story from a recent book by author Suzanne Collins. It acts as the follow-up prequel after 2023's The Ballad of Songbirds & Snakes. Returning to the director's chair is Francis Lawrence, who directed most of the previous films in the series.
The Plot and New Cast
The film's story are set 24 years before the first Hunger Games, centering on a young Haymitch Abernathy. Haymitch, who would later become Katniss's mentor, is featured as a tribute in the brutal 50th Hunger Games.
The film welcomes several notable actors in pivotal roles:
- Jesse Plemons steps into the role of Plutarch Heavensbee.
- Ralph Fiennes will appear as a earlier incarnation of the calculating President Snow.

Regarding the shoot:
- Principal photography commenced in the summer of 2025.
- Filming was completed in November of the same year.
- The eagerly awaited film is targeting a November 2026 release.
